#196213 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#196213 is composed of 9.8% red, 38.4% green and 7.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 80.6%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 115.4 degrees, a saturation of 67.5% and a lightness of 22.9%. #196213 color hex could be obtained by blending #32c426 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

● #196213 color description : Very dark lime green.
#196213 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#196213 has RGB values of R:25, G:98, B:19 and CMYK values of C:0.74, M:0, Y:0.81,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 1663507.
